Tom Wolfe Quotes

Like More Than One Englishman In New York, He Looked Upon Americans As Hopeless Children Whom Providence Had Perversely Provided With This Great Swollen Fat Fowl Of A Continent. Any Way One Chose To Relieve Them Of Their Riches, Short Of Violence, Was Sporting, If Not Morally Justifiable, Since They Would Only Squander It In Some Tasteless And Useless Fashion, In Any Event.
